My husband and I (who are both Australian citizens) are about to start an extended world-wide trip. We will be entering China on an organised tour from Mongolia in June 2010, and leaving from Beijing approximately 1 week later. I believe we need a single entry Chinese visa to cover our stay?

As we will shortly be leaving Australia, we would like to apply for our visa's now. Our question is, will the visa's be valid for three months from the date they are issued, or from the date that we enter China?

Mrs. Fox, the visa will be valid for three months from the date they are issued, you have to enter China before the last date specified on your Chinese visa. Otherwise, the visa expires and you can't use it to enter China. for example, you get a single entry tourist visa, issued on March 15, enter before June 15, Duration of Stay 030 days after each entry, then you have to use the visa to enter China before June 15, and stay in China for 30 days after entry.
